Hazing: How to hide in nearly plain sight | Student Science

A new invisibility cloak can hide objects in semi-plain sight — sometimes. Unlike earlier cloaking devices, this one can conceal things from light of any color and coming from any direction. But that flexibility comes at a price: This cloak only works under hazy conditions, such as in fog, in a cloud or when viewed through frosted glass.
